Keep Some Mental Stimulation Throughout the Day
First and foremost, there is certainly a lot that you can be doing in terms of ensuring that you keep up a good level of mental stimulation throughout the day. There are plenty of steps that you can be taking on this front. To begin with, you can try taking on some puzzles and little games for just a few minutes, and many of these can be found for free on mobile devices. If you would like to try things in just a little bit more depth, you can always look into learning a new language. Studies have shown that bilingual people can have the risk of dementia cut in a significant way. Socialize Regularly
There is also something to be said for socializing regularly with people who are close to you. If you do not have that much in the way of regular social interactions, you can look into the option of joining a new club or a society. Ultimately, when you are interacting with people, you are being presented with new routes of conversations and different challenges that you are not facing if you remain all by yourself all the time. This is a great way to keep your brain engaged and develop some wonderful relationships along the way.
Try to Get into a Better Sleep Pattern
Next up on the list, there is certainly a lot that you can be doing in terms of getting into a better sleep pattern, which is also closely linked to your memory. There are plenty of different steps that you can take on this front, including ensuring that you keep to a regular bedtime every night. Not only this, but you can also try engaging in some regular relaxing activities during the evening that will help to promote restful sleep.
